Treat your tastebuds to a global adventure at Alton FlavourFest when the town hosts it's annual free food and drink festival from 11am to 4pm on Sunday 7 September.
Get ready for a gastronomic extravaganza, with over 60 vibrant food and drink stalls, sizzling street eats, irresistible cookery demonstrations, cocktail, cider and real ale bars, family-friendly fun, and a mouth-watering lineup of live music on the bandstand.
The festival hosts lovingly created food and drink, created and sourced by leading producers from across the South East. Those with a sweet tooth will enjoy handmade chocolates, scrumptious cakes and bakes and hand crafted desserts, while the savoury stalls will offer freshly baked bread, charcuterie, pies, chilli sauces, jams and chutneys, cheeses, oils and much more!
Over at the live cookery demonstrations, there's lots to discover with The Natural Cook Company, as they share their best tips and recipes.
Hot on the heels of the grown-ups, children can enjoy face painting, biscuit decorating and free children's crafts.
Entrance to the festival is free.
